Itinerary
Just before we begin with our Marmaris Jeep Safari, we pick our guests from their hotels in our comfortable jeeps and then move to the meeting area. In a place on the highlands just above the town, we regroup before beginning with our safari.
Off Road Area & Water Guns: After a short drive of 15 minutes, we arrive to a small field on a mountain in the out skirts of Marmaris. Before moving along, we advise our guests to get water guns available on rent. You will need them for a good use at the end of our journey. The safari is scheduled mostly in a hilly area with dirt, mud and water all around. During the next few hours, we drive off-road on muddy tracks and get really wet and dusty. It’s time to make use of the water guns here. Fill your guns with water and clean your dirt by firing bursts of water at each other.
Comfort Break : After an hour of adventurous off-road journey, we arrive to the place where we take a comfort break. This place has a small swimming pool, showers, a cafeteria and toilets. This serves as an ideal place to take some rest and refreshment in between.
Just outside a local village, we visit the waterfall and spend an hour there. You can swim in the waterfall, but don’t forget that this water is very cold even during the midsummer!
Lunch Break: After hours of adventurous traveling and playing in waters, it’s time to take a lunch break. The main course is chicken along with some tasty and authentic local Turkish food. Omelet can be arranged for the vegetarians. The starters and salads are served as open buffet. Drinks are also available, but they are not included in the tour price.
Jesus Beach: This is a special place at Hisarönü near Marmaris. At this beautiful beach people can walk on an elevated seabed right in the middle of the sea. It is a truly amazing place to visit. At this place we spend an hour where you can swim and get relaxed.
At the end of the tour, we drive back home and drop our guests to their hotels at around 16:30 in the evening.

It was a fun day out! We got picked up by our jeep directly from the hotel and then made our way to a random shop/cafe where we sat for around 30 minutes waiting for everyone else. We then made our way to a lay by sort of area where you were given the option to rent water guns for 250TL before driving around a loop having a water fight which our jeep did not do so I can’t comment on but be prepared to get soaked it you get involved even without a water gun! After this we drove over to the waterfall which you have to walk up a steep rocky incline to (only a few minutes) and it isn’t really anything special other than a small waterfall. After the waterfall we had lunch which was grilled chicken skewer with rice and salad or a plain omelette, rice and salad if veggie. Chips and drinks are extra. We then went to Jesus beach which was slightly underwhelming and despite it being quite cool that you can walk out into the middle of the sea it doesn’t actually look like walking on water. They also charge 30tl to use the toilets here despite being free at every other stop so use the toilets before if you can. We were then taken back to our hotel by the jeeps. The jeeps do overtake each other on twisty mountain roads which feels unsafe so I wouldn’t recommend for people who don’t like these roads. There are also about 4/5 stops at random places where you can buy a drink/snacks and go to the toilet and sit for about 30 minutes at a time which seemed a bit unnecessary. Overall a good day out but not our favourite of activities due to all the stops.
